Webenergy required to charge the MOSFET gate. That is, the Q G(TOT) at the gate voltage of the circuit. These are both turn-on and turn-off gate losses. Most of the power is in the MOSFET gate driver. Gate-drive losses are frequency dependent and are also a func-tion of the gate capacitance of the MOSFETs. When turning the MOSFET on and off, the ... To measure gate threshold voltage of a MOSFET, at first, short Gate pin and Drain pin, and then, with a given I D =250μA, and monitor the voltage difference between Gate-Source. One significant characteristics of V GS(TH) is its negative temperature coefficient. This grocery stores in pipestone mnWebEFFECTIVE GATE CAPACITANCE The Mosfet input capacitance (Ciss) is frequently misused as the load represented by a power mosfet to the gate driver IC. In reality, the effective input capacitance of a Mosfet (Ceff) is much higher, and must be derived from the manufacturers’ published total gate charge (Qg) information.
